What Does Effective Communication Training Involve?

One of the biggest misconceptions is that communication training is generic or simplistic. In reality, high-quality training is comprehensive and tailored, focusing on multiple dimensions of communication. Some of the key components include:

1. Active Listening

Do we really listen, or are we just waiting for our turn to speak? Active listening teaches professionals to focus, reflect, and respond thoughtfully, ensuring the message is fully understood before reacting.

2. Body Language and Non-verbal Communication

Up to 93% of communication can be non-verbal. Training helps you become aware of how your posture, eye contact, gestures, and facial expressions affect your message.

3. Conflict Resolution and Assertiveness

Disagreements are inevitable. The goal of training is to handle them constructively—through assertiveness, empathy, and a focus on shared outcomes rather than personal differences.

4. Presentation and Public Speaking Skills

Whether you’re pitching an idea to investors or leading a team meeting, training helps build confidence in verbal delivery, storytelling, and visual communication.

5. Cultural and Emotional Intelligence

Canada’s multicultural work environment demands sensitivity to different communication styles. Training enhances your ability to navigate these differences respectfully and effectively.

Through these modules, professionals learn to adapt their communication for various scenarios, personalities, and platforms—making them more versatile and impactful in the workplace.

How Can Communication Training Transform Professional Relationships?

Effective communication training doesn’t just improve how we talk—it transforms how we work, collaborate, and grow professionally. In any workplace, miscommunication can lead to delays, conflict, or even financial loss. But when teams learn to communicate better, the results are both immediate and long-lasting. Here’s a closer look at how improved communication reshapes professional relationships within an organisation:

➤ Stronger Trust Among Team Members

When individuals learn to express themselves clearly, honestly, and with empathy, a natural sense of trust develops within the team. Team members become more willing to share ideas, ask for help, and offer constructive feedback without fear of judgment. This kind of open communication leads to stronger collaboration and makes managers more approachable and effective in their leadership roles.

➤ Greater Respect for Diverse Perspectives

A well-structured communication training program helps employees understand the importance of listening actively and acknowledging different viewpoints. This promotes mutual respect across departments and hierarchies. Whether you’re interacting with senior executives or junior colleagues, communication becomes a tool for inclusion and cooperation rather than division or dominance.

➤ Improved Workplace Efficiency

Misunderstandings can waste a lot of time. When everyone is trained to communicate expectations, timelines, and responsibilities clearly, projects flow more smoothly. There are fewer repeated tasks, reduced errors, and less time spent clarifying instructions. This increased clarity boosts overall productivity and ensures resources are used effectively.

➤ Increased Opportunities for Leadership and Career Growth

Professionals who are articulate, persuasive, and confident communicators often stand out. They are more likely to be chosen to lead meetings, manage projects, or represent the company externally. Communication training equips individuals with presentation skills, negotiation tactics, and emotional intelligence—all of which are key traits of effective leaders. Over time, these individuals are more likely to be promoted and trusted with greater responsibilities.
